source: projects/specs/trunk/g/gnome-desktop3/gnome-desktop3-vl.spec @ 7119

Revision 7119, 4.4 KB checked in by Takemikaduchi, 12 years ago (diff)

GNOME-3.6.2

Line 
1%define glib2_version 2.34.0
2%define pango_version 1.32.0
3%define gtk3_version 3.6.0
4%define startup_notification_version 0.10
5
6%define po_package gnome-desktop-3.0
7
8Summary: Package containing code shared among gnome-panel, gnome-session, nautilus, etc.
9Summary(ja): gnome-panel, gnome-session, nautilus などの共用プログラム
10Name: gnome-desktop3
11Version: 3.6.2
12Release: 1%{?_dist_release}
13URL: http://www.gnome.org/
14Source0: http://ftp.gnome.org/pub/GNOME/sources/gnome-desktop/3.6/gnome-desktop-%{version}.tar.xz
15License: GPL
16Group: User Interface/Desktops
17
18Vendor: Project Vine
19Distribution: Vine Linux
20Packager: Takemikaduchi
21
22BuildRoot: %{_tmppath}/%{name}-%{version}-root
23
24# Requires for Vine
25Requires: ibus-gtk3
26Requires: gnome-icon-theme-symbolic
27Requires: gnome-themes
28Requires: gnome-themes-standard
29Requires: gnome-themes-vine
30Requires: gsettings-desktop-schemas
31
32Obsoletes: gnome-core gnome-core-devel
33Provides: gnome-core
34
35BuildRequires: glib2-devel >= %{glib2_version}
36BuildRequires: pango-devel >= %{pango_version}
37BuildRequires: gtk3-devel >= %{gtk3_version}
38BuildRequires: startup-notification-devel >= %{startup_notification_version}
39BuildRequires: gsettings-desktop-schemas-devel
40BuildRequires: libXrandr-devel
41BuildRequires: libxkbfile-devel
42BuildRequires: xkeyboard-config
43BuildRequires: autoconf, automake
44BuildRequires: yelp-tools
45BuildRequires: docbook-utils
46
47%description
48
49The gnome-desktop package contains an internal library
50(libgnomedesktop3) used to implement some portions of the GNOME
51desktop, and also some data files and other shared components of the
52GNOME user environment.
53
54%package devel
55Summary: Libraries and headers for libgnome-desktop
56Summary(ja): libgnome-desktop の開発用ライブラリおよびヘッダファイル
57Group: Development/Libraries
58Requires: %{name} = %{version}-%{release}
59
60Requires: glib2-devel >= %{glib2_version}
61Requires: gtk3-devel >= %{gtk3_version}
62Requires: startup-notification-devel >= %{startup_notification_version}
63
64%description devel
65
66Libraries and header files for the GNOME-internal private library
67libgnomedesktop
68
69%prep
70%setup -q -n gnome-desktop-%{version}
71
72%build
73%configure --with-gnome-distributor="Project Vine" --disable-scrollkeeper
74make %{?_smp_mflags}
75
76%install
77rm -rf $RPM_BUILD_ROOT
78
79make install DESTDIR=$RPM_BUILD_ROOT
80
81rm -f $RPM_BUILD_ROOT%{_libdir}/*.la
82rm -f $RPM_BUILD_ROOT%{_libdir}/*.a
83
84%find_lang %{po_package}
85
86%clean
87rm -rf $RPM_BUILD_ROOT
88
89%post -p /sbin/ldconfig
90
91%postun -p /sbin/ldconfig
92
93
94%files -f %{po_package}.lang
95%defattr(-,root,root)
96%doc AUTHORS COPYING ChangeLog NEWS README
97%{_libdir}/lib*.so.*
98%{_libdir}/girepository-1.0/GnomeDesktop-3.0.typelib
99%{_libexecdir}/gnome-rr-debug
100%{_datadir}/libgnome-desktop-3.0
101%{_datadir}/gnome/*
102%{_datadir}/help/*/*/*
103
104%files devel
105%defattr(-,root,root)
106%{_libdir}/lib*.so
107%{_libdir}/pkgconfig/*.pc
108%{_includedir}/*
109%{_datadir}/gir-1.0/GnomeDesktop-3.0.gir
110%{_datadir}/gtk-doc
111
112%changelog
113* Wed Nov 14 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.6.2-1
114- new upstream release
115- remove Patch0 (gnome-desktop-3.6.1-ja.po.patch)
116
117* Fri Oct 26 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.6.1-2
118- update Patch0 (gnome-desktop-3.6.1-ja.po.patch)
119
120* Wed Oct 10 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.6.1-1
121- new upstream release
122
123* Wed Oct 10 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.6.0.1-2
124- add Patch0 (gnome-desktop-3.6.0.1-ja.po.patch)
125
126* Wed Oct 03 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.6.0.1-1
127- new upstream release
128- add BuildRequires: libxkbfile-devel, xkeyboard-config
129- change BuildRequires: yelp-tools instead of gnome-doc-utils
130
131* Sun May 20 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.4.2-1
132- new upstream release
133
134* Sun Apr 22 2012 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.4.1-1
135- new upstream release
136- change BuildRequires: gsettings-desktop-schemas-devel instead of gsettings-desktop-schemas
137
138* Fri Oct 21 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.2.1-1
139- new upstream release
140
141* Wed Sep 28 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.2.0-1
142- new upstream release
143
144* Fri Sep 23 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.1.92-1
145- new upstream release
146
147* Sun Sep 18 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.1.91-1
148- new upstream release
149
150* Sat Sep 03 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.1.90.1-1
151- new upstream release
152
153* Sun Aug 21 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.1.5-1
154- new upstream release
155
156* Thu Aug 18 2011 Yoji TOYODA <bsyamato@sea.plala.or.jp> 3.1.4-1
157- initial build for Vine Linux
Note: See TracBrowser for help on using the repository browser.